Well, first of all, it's best to *not* use digest. You use gmail, so
all of the e-mails would be threaded together automatically if you
turned digest off.
If you won't turn off digest mode, you should probably copy the
"Subject" for the message you're replying to and put that as the
subject for the new e-mail you create.
